Abstract: A door connector for a litter container includes a base portion and a hook. The base portion is configured to attach to an interior surface of a hood of the litter container. The hook is configured to attach to a cylindrical connector on the door. The base portion is configured to attach to the interior surface such that when connected the hook is at least partially hidden when viewed from an exterior of the litter container.

Abstract: Division is realized with a small number of processing stages. A secure computation apparatus (1) obtains a secret value representing a result of divided N by D using a secret value [N] of a real number N and a secret value [D] of a natural number D. An initialization unit (12) sets a secret value [PL1] of a partial remainder PL1 to 0. A parallel comparison unit (13) computes secret values [E1], . . . , [ER?1] of comparison results E1, . . . , ER?1 of comparing a secret value [n] of a partial divisor n=Pj+1R+Nj with [D]×g for each integer g not less than 1 and less than R in parallel. An update unit (14) computes a secret value [Qj] of a quotient Qj and a secret value [Pj] of a partial remainder Pj that satisfy n=DQj+Pj using the secret values [E1], . . . , [ER?1] of the comparison results E1, . . . , ER?1. An iterative control unit (15) executes the parallel comparison unit (13) and the update unit (14) for each integer j from L1?1 to ?L0.

Abstract: A prosthetic system includes first and second parts rotatable relative to one another about a joint. The first and second parts are adapted to form at least part of a weight bearing connection between a prosthetic foot and a socket. A pump system includes a pump mechanism operatively connected to the first and second parts. Rotation of the first part and/or the second part about the joint moves the pump mechanism between an original configuration in which the volume of a fluid chamber defined by the pump mechanism is zero or near-zero, and an expanded configuration in which the volume of the fluid chamber is increased.

Abstract: A prosthetic cover for a prosthetic support element can include a substantially cylindrical hollow body with a first end and a second end and sized to fit around a support element of a prosthesis. A first flexible end seal and a second flexible end seal can each attach with the substantially cylindrical hollow body at the first and second ends, respectively, and connect the hollow body with the support element of the prosthesis by deforming about the support element when the prosthetic cover is installed around the support element.
Abstract: A method for manufacturing an additively-manufactured object, includes: an additively-manufacturing step of building a layered body by depositing a weld bead obtained by melting and solidifying a filler metal, the layered body having an opening along a forming direction of the weld bead and an internal space surrounded by the weld bead; and a closing step of forming a closing wall portion connecting an edge portion of the opening with the weld bead for closing. In the additively-manufacturing step, the opening is formed with a width dimension larger than a bead width of the weld bead, and in the closing step, the closing wall portion having a width dimension larger than the bead width is formed by the weld bead to close the opening.
Abstract: The embodiments of the present application provide a fixing device and a detection system. The fixing device includes: a bearing disk used for bearing a lapping head, the bearing disk being provided with positioning holes and a first positioning ring, the positioning holes being used for accommodating and fixing a positioning pin of a first type of lapping head, and the first positioning ring being used for fixing a positioning disk of a second type of lapping head.
